Transaction 403b8568e1dba8134176ec497c5f8d4d70a49a5b6311a4194308b5c43e9f4a6a
1 Input
1 Output
-
403b8568e1dba8134176ec497c5f8d4d70a49a5b6311a4194308b5c43e9f4a6a:0
- value
- 1588082
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5ef064104f2f0696afa3d0719be61c4e4e6128c OP_EQUAL
- address
- 3MCCC7TYZhicwvxTpnYvPp9ubrz9srtecg